Across TCGA patient cohorts, OGA protein abundance is significantly associated with the RNA expression of many other genes, with 11,358 significant associations in total. GBM shows the largest number of these associations.

The most reproducible OGA-associated genes across cancer lineages are SLC25A28, POLR3A, and COX15. Each is linked with OGA in more than 4 cancer types. Because this analysis shows association rather than direction, both OGA-to-partner and partner-to-OGA results are reported.
